![]() Georgy Balanchivadze was born in 1904 in St. Petersburg. At the age of nine, he was enrolled in the ballet school at the Mariinsky Theater . After the October Revolution, the educational institution was closed, which is why George was able to return to his studies only a few years later. After graduation, he was accepted into the troupe of the State Theater of Opera and Ballet , where the ballerina Lidia Ivanova became his muse. However, the girl soon died under unclear circumstances. In 1924, while on tour in Germany, Balanchivadze accepted Sergei Diaghilev's invitation to stay in Europe and take the position of choreographer of the USA Ballet . At the same time, the famous entrepreneur suggested George to change his name and surname in the Western manner - George Balanchine .
